Event Details
Gerard Brophy's new work Tibrogargan will be premiered in KPO's 2020 season opening concert, which also includes the Famous Fives - Beethoven's Piano Concerto No 5, The Emperor, and Shostakovich's epic Symphony No 5.
Soloist, Leanne Jin was winner of the 2019 Lev Vlassenko Competition and the 2019 Sydney Eisteddfod Kawai Piano Scholarship.She has also been a prize winner in KPO's own Concerto Competition, now in its 36th year. Tibrogargan is one of the Glasshouse Mountains in Queensland and in Aboriginal mythology, the father of the mountains.
